Has anyone painted the outside of their cast iron bath?

4 replies

Kitsmummy · 30/08/2015 08:42

Hi, I'm having my bathroom done and having an old claw foot bath in but the outside of it is green and I want to change it.

Do I need to sand, prime (which primer?) and then use an oil eggshell, or do you know if I can just use oil eggshell straight on top of the current green (which is in good condition)? Thanks

Acer77 · 31/08/2015 18:19

You'd be fine to paint it - farrow and ball do both primers and paint for metal and I know they are ok for baths as lots of cast iron bath makers use their paints now www.farrow-ball.com/preparing-interior-metal/content/fcp-content
